About Cape May Fleet

In 1993, long time whale and dolphin watching as well as sightseeing Captain Jeff Stewart started a new business, called the Cape May Whale Watcher. The day the Cape May Whale Watcher and Captain Jeff Stewart came to Cape May, NJ, a new standard was set for marine mammal watching, eco-tourism, dinner cruising, sightseeing, charter and party boats in Southern New Jersey. He set the bar high, and to date no one has surpassed this original standard of the largest and the fastest boat with the Marine Mammal Sighting Guarantee.

The Cape May Whale Watcher, our original boat, is all aluminum, making for a very strong, yet lightweight hull. This coupled with her 4 diesel engines producing 1600HP push her to speeds in excess of 25 knots. Fast is important. We may go slow when in search mode, but when the report comes in and we are off to the races, speed can mean the difference between 5 minutes of viewing and a half an hour or more of viewing. Maximized viewing time means maximized value.

The length of the Cape May Whale Watcher- registered by the United States Coast Guard at 98.6 ft, is over 20 feet longer than our competitors largest boat. Add on the bow pulpit, and you have a 110 foot long beast of a boat. Prior to 1993, if you went whale and dolphin watching in New Jersey and did not see anything, you were told "too bad, should have been here yesterday." In 1993, we started our quest in better Customer Service by offering the first Marine Mammals Sightings Guaranteed in the state of NJ. If we do not sight marine mammals (whales or dolphins or porpoise) we offer a free pass for another trip in the future. Unline our competitors- we have plenty of space and have never turned away a free pass, our free pass never expires, and we do not believe in one dolphin "getting us off the hook (for the Guarantee)." Jeff Stewart believes that if he did not have a good trip- how could you have had a good trip. So, since 1993, our policy has been there is no such thing as getting off the hook for our guarantee.
